Сайт MVC, который работает локально, не работает после развертывания - PullRequest
1 голос
/ 11 мая 2011

У меня есть asp.net-mvc, который подключается к базе данных Sybase IQ. Он работает локально, но при его развертывании появляется сообщение об ошибке:

[Microsoft] [Диспетчер драйверов ODBC] Имя источника данных не найдено и драйвер по умолчанию не указан]

Эта веб-страница подключается к базе данных sybase с помощью:

ODBCConnection

класс. Я не вижу никаких других внешних библиотек, которые кажутся ссылками, которых раньше не было.

Моя строка подключения: ( ПРИМЕЧАНИЕ : я заменяю фактическую информацию на []):

const string CONN_STRING = "DSN=SybaseDB;Eng=[DBNAME];Links=tcpip(Host=[server];Port=[MyPort]);UID=[username];PWD=[pwd];";

Может кто-нибудь подсказать, что может отсутствовать на веб-сервере, чтобы заставить это работать?

Ответы [ 2 ]

2 голосов
/ 11 мая 2011

Возможно, вам потребуется настроить драйвер ODBC на сервере.

0 голосов
/ 11 мая 2011

Необходимо создать соединение ODBC DSN на удаленном сервере.

...